Saving time, increasing efficience etc is nice as long as it fits the bottom line. I used to fly privately say 1-2 times a year, bit less than that now Anyway I used it only for mission-impossible trips, usually a scenario was that some urgent meeting was falling in between two other very important meetings same day or overnight and it was virtually impossible to make it with scheduled services. Even then I had to take a deep breath and think twice if attending this particular meeting really worth anything between 10 to 30k EUR (as opposed to conference call for almost free or 500-900 EUR ticket a day later). Here I'm talking about light or mid-size bizjet for intra-european trip. Going across the pond (US East coast) will settle you for some 60-80k EUR, Far East even more than that. Probably I'm in a wrong business.

If you have a group of people to travel, especially 5+ it becomes not so prohibitive, but flying solo is simply too expensive unless you heading to conclude an 7-digit+ contract on spot which will not happen otherwise. We are not talking here about hiring a piston Cessna-172, are we?
